2017-05-03 5 views
1

내가 알고 싶은 것은 장치 네트워크 대신 WIFI를 통과해야하는 로깅을 결정하는 방법입니다. 로그 엔트리 SDK의 일부로 메소드가 있습니까안드로이드 로그 엔트리에서 WIFI 연결을 사용하여 데이터를 기록하는 방법 SDK

+0

이 링크를 통해 이동하십시오. http://stackoverflow.com/questions/9353005/android-wifi-how-to-detect-when-specific-wifi-connection-is-available – Vasant

+0

sdk에 기본 옵션이 있습니까 – Rakesh

답변

0

와이파이 연결을 위해이 코드를 사용해보십시오.

private boolean checkConnectedToDesiredWifi() { 
    boolean connected = false; 
    WifiManager wifiManager =(WifiManager) context.getSystemService(Context.WIFI_SERVICE); 
    WifiInfo wifiInf = wifiManager.getConnectionInfo(); 
    String desiredMacAddress = wifiInf.getMacAddress(); 
    WifiInfo wifi = wifiManager.getConnectionInfo(); 
    if (wifi != null) { 
     // get current router Mac address 
     String bssid = wifi.getBSSID(); 
     connected = desiredMacAddress.equals(bssid); 
    } 

    return connected; 
} 
+0

기본 옵션이 있는지 묻습니다 이 SDK에서 사용하려면 WIFI 연결을 확인하고 내 끝에서 수동으로 로그인하지 마십시오 – Rakesh

+0

코드가 없으면 어떤 옵션이 있는지 알 수 없습니다. – Vasant